* QNetworkDiskCache: use QSaveFileMårten Nordheim2023-03-091-36/+17
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| QTemporaryFile is not designed to promote temporary files to non-temporary files. So, it, quite importantly, does not care if the content of the files are flushed to disk before renaming it into its 'final' destination. This is what QSaveFile is for. * QNetworkDiskCache: Fix tracking of size during storeItem()Mårten Nordheim2021-07-201-3/+1
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| If the file already existed we simply removed the old one without adjusting the size. So use the removeFile() function which takes care of that. Additionally, if the current size was non-null we previously increased the size (presumably meant to be temporarily but wasn't) and called expire() which would either: 1. not do anything and return currentCacheSize, if it was not greater than the max size. This would mean that the size of the file would be counted twice. or, 2. discard currentCacheSize, measure the size of the items, and then remove some items if the total size surpassed the max cache size Neither of those branches need us to (temporarily) increase currentCacheSize. It also doesn't attain the (presumed) goal of trying to keep below the max cache size after having added the new item. * Added stream version into network cache file formatNikita Krupenko2014-07-171-1/+9
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| At the moment, there is no stream information in the cache file. This can lead to a problem when current stream version differs from version cache file written with. As an example, if file written with Qt 5.1.1, QTimeDate in the metadata stored as 13-bytes value, but Qt 5.2 and later can read additional 4 bytes which breaks following data, leading to network request just hangs forever. Adding stream version fixes this problem. As cache format changed, cache version bumped.
